Abstract :
Sliding mode variable structure controller design is mostly based on pole assignment principle to select the sliding mode surface, however, because of the selection of the poles are based on single parameter and experience, so that the design of sliding mode surface is not the most reasonable. This paper use the simplex algorithm to optimize design the sliding mode plane function and put forward the Integral Performance Index, which is based on the principle of pole assignment. This method make the switching function of sliding surface is more reasonable and ideal, which is used for controlling rudder roll stabilization, roll reduction rate can reach 43%. It is better than only based on pole assignment to select sliding mode surface.
